Tax Time - remember to claim sport expenses for children! Line 365 - Children's fitness amount: You can claim, up to $500 per child, the fees paid in 2007 that relate to the cost of registering your child, or your spouse or common-law partner's child, in a prescribed program of physical activity. The child must have been under 16 years of age at the beginning of the year. For more information, click here.
Line 214 Child Care Expenses: You or your spouse or common-law partner may have paid for someone to look after your child so one of you could earn income, go to school, or conduct research in 2007. The expenses are deductible only if, at some time in 2007, the child was under 16 or had a mental or physical impairment. For more information, click here.
Note: You may have paid an amount that would qualify to be claimed as child care expenses (line 214) and the children's fitness amount. If this is the case, you must first claim this amount as child care expenses. Any unused part can be claimed for the children's fitness amount as long as the requirements are met.
